I drove my car yesterday and the fuel pump did not run before starting the car. And the car started fine. 3 times.

I think I remember in the past the pump would run until I started the car.
If the pressure regulator has not bled down to zero pressure, the fuel pump won't run. Mine does if it has been sitting over night.

The pump you are talking about might just be the electric vac pump in right front of engine compartment. This pump will activate for a few seconds when the key is turned on. It should go off. If it runs for more than 10 seconds you might have a vac leak. The pump may not come on if the resivor is full.
